Quick Summary: A tachometer is a mechanical or electronic instrument specifically designed to measure the instantaneous rotational speed of a shaft or disk in a machine, typically expressed in revolutions per minute (RPM). It is a vital diagnostic tool used during the installation, commissioning, and preventive maintenance of rotating electrical machines like motors and generators.

Tachometers operate based on various principles including magnetic induction, optical reflection, or centrifugal force. In an optical tachometer, a laser or infrared beam is reflected off a reflective marker on the rotating object; the sensor detects these pulses, and the circuitry calculates speed based on the frequency of the returning pulses: RPM=tinterval60. Alternatively, eddy current tachometers use a rotating magnet to induce eddy currents in a metal disk, creating a torque proportional to speed.
